Merge tag 'for-linus-6.7-rc1-tag' of git://git.kernel.org/pub/scm/linux/kernel/git/xen/tip

Pull xen updates from Juergen Gross:

 - two small cleanup patches

 - a fix for PCI passthrough under Xen

 - a four patch series speeding up virtio under Xen with user space
   backends

* tag 'for-linus-6.7-rc1-tag' of git://git.kernel.org/pub/scm/linux/kernel/git/xen/tip:
  xen-pciback: Consider INTx disabled when MSI/MSI-X is enabled
  xen: privcmd: Add support for ioeventfd
  xen: evtchn: Allow shared registration of IRQ handers
  xen: irqfd: Use _IOW instead of the internal _IOC() macro
  xen: Make struct privcmd_irqfd's layout architecture independent
  xen/xenbus: Add __counted_by for struct read_buffer and use struct_size()
  xenbus: fix error exit in xenbus_init()

Linux kernel
============

There are several guides for kernel developers and users. These guides can
be rendered in a number of formats, like HTML and PDF. Please read
Documentation/admin-guide/README.rst first.

In order to build the documentation, use ``make htmldocs`` or
``make pdfdocs``.  The formatted documentation can also be read online at:

    https://www.kernel.org/doc/html/latest/

There are various text files in the Documentation/ subdirectory,
several of them using the Restructured Text markup notation.

Please read the Documentation/process/changes.rst file, as it contains the
requirements for building and running the kernel, and information about
the problems which may result by upgrading your kernel.
